Finding light for Spinach 'Red Veined' in your home
a window
Spinach 'Red Veined' love being close to bright, sunny windows 😎.
Place it less than 1ft from a south-facing window to maximize the potential for growth.
Spinach 'Red Veined' does not tolerate low-light 🚫.

How to fertilize Spinach 'Red Veined'
Most potting soils come with ample nutrients which plants use to produce new growth.
By the time your plant has depleted the nutrients in its soil it’s likely grown enough to need a larger pot anyway.
To replenish this plant's nutrients, repot your Spinach 'Red Veined' after it doubles in size or once a year—whichever comes first.
